Replaces the rustypipe-backed extraction with calls into the new
NPE-port crate. The UniFFI surface Kotlin sees is unchanged:
suspend fun search(query: String): List<SearchItem>
suspend fun streamInfo(input: String): StreamInfo
suspend fun channelInfo(input: String): ChannelInfo
fun initLogging() // also wires the strawcore-core Downloader
fun helloFromRust(name: String): String
rust/strawcore/
* Cargo.toml — dropped rustypipe + rquickjs-sys direct dep;
added strawcore-core path dep (../../../strawcore)
* src/error.rs — From<strawcore_core::ExtractionError>, mapping
ContentUnavailable variants to typed
StrawcoreError cases (AgeRestricted, GeoRestricted,
Private, RequiresLogin) instead of bucketing all
to Extractor
* src/runtime.rs — Once-guarded ReqwestDownloader init via
NewPipe::init_full
* src/search.rs — search() spawn_blocks core search_extractor::search
against SearchFilter::Videos
* src/stream.rs — stream_info() resolves URL → video_id via
strawcore_core::linkhandler::stream, then
spawn_blocks core stream_extractor::stream_info,
then maps StreamInfo → wrapper DTOs (combined/
video_only/audio_only/dash/hls)
* src/channel.rs — channel_info() parses input via
strawcore_core::linkhandler::channel (handle /
custom-url / legacy-user resolution lives in
core), then spawn_blocks core channel::channel_info
Build verified: wrapper compiles linking strawcore-core, uniffi-bindgen
generates Kotlin bindings with the same suspend fun + data class
surface Kotlin already consumes. Android NDK cross-compile + APK + on-
device smoke pending (needs crafting-table container).
This commits onto rollback/vc18-back-to-NPE — the existing Kotlin code
still calls NewPipeExtractor directly. Switching the Kotlin side to
consume the rust wrapper is a separate cutover.
